摘要
A new way which integrates QFD and TRIZ felicitously is presented in this paper to solve the problems in the production design today. This new method can help business enterprises improve their power of market competition. The house of quality has been founded according to the users' requirement. Conflict and type of the design can be confirmed by the negative correlation items, which exist in sensitive matrix of the house of quality. Conflict resolution principle is chosen from TRIZ to resolve the conflict of physics and technology. At last, we verify this new technique though an actual project and gain an ideal result.
